Therapy

It must be noted that the therapy of schizophrenic residuals is often complicated. While classical antipsychotics, such as haloperidol, have only very little effect on the symptom spectrum, atypical antipsychotics (olanzapine, clozapine, etc.) show better demand rates.

Unfortunately, like all drugs in this class, they are often associated with side effects. These include significant weight gain, changes in electrical cardiac activity (QT time extension) and strong sedative properties. Furthermore, due to the very similar symptoms, antidepressants are used in the therapy of schizophrenic residuals.
